The extensive run includes 45 shows that go on sale today and coincide with the release of the first radio single \u2013 Wheels. The new song from the forthcoming Backroad Nation album features the accompanying music video that was filmed on location in outback Northern Territory.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;It was absolutely spectacular out in that desert country and we were shooting in 46-degree heat &#8211; it was even too hot for the flies,\u201d Lee recalls. Lee\u2019s wife Robby also made a special appearance in the music video donning bikinis and Akubra hat. \u201cWhen I first asked Robby if she\u2019d be in the clip she said no,\u201d he says. \u201cSo, I had to sweeten the deal and I bribed her with a couple of of cold beers at Lasseter\u2019s Casino.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Lee says the Backroad Nation album and tour is a celebration of \u2018us, our way of life and the people who make our country great\u2019. \u201cMuch of the inspiration for the songs has come from the people I\u2019ve met and the places I\u2019ve travelled to, from Alice Springs to the Deni Ute Muster, from the mighty Pilbara region in WA to the backroads of Queensland, and everywhere in between,\u201d he says.<\/p>\n<p>Kernaghan who has 38 number one songs to his credit says the new tour will feature all the hits and a whole lot more. \u201cWe\u2019ve been working on creating a concert event that I hope people are going to really love being a part of,\u201d he says. \u201cA lot of new design elements have been added with the staging, lighting and screens plus the hottest band in the land, The Wolfe Brothers will be joining me and opening up the shows with a bunch of their own hits.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The Wolfe Brothers made country music history in January becoming the first group to win four Golden Guitars in one night including the big one, Album Of The Year, for their outstanding release, Country Heart. One of Australia\u2019s brightest new stars, Christie Lamb will also join Lee for his Backroad Nation Tour. Christie has notched up multiple number one hits on the charts; she was the Golden Guitar winner for New Talent Of The Year and in 2018 and was voted CMC Female Artist Of The Year.<\/p>\n<p>Lee Kernaghan is considered a legend in the Australian music industry and for good reason. He has achieved a staggering 38 #1 chart hit songs including Boys From The Bush, Hat Town, Flying With The King, Australian Boy, Texas QLD 4385, Goondiwindi Moon, High Country and a veritable ute load of Golden Guitars &#8211; 37 in total. Lee has also won four ARIA Awards including The ARIA Special Achievement Award for the Spirit Of The Anzacs album &#8211; the Number One all genres album of 2015 and Highest Selling Australian Album Of The Year.<\/p>\n<p>Tickets to the Backroad Nation Tour are on sale today. Lee Kernaghan\u2019s new album Backroad Nation is set for release on May 10 through ABC Music. The first single from the album, Wheels, is at radio today.
